Rays | Drew Smyly seeking second opinion
Updating a previous report, Tampa Bay Rays SP Drew Smyly (shoulder) is headed to Texas to have the torn labrum in his left shoulder examined by Dr. Keith Meister of the Texas Rangers. There still has not been a final decision on whether Smyly will opt for surgery.  Source: The Tampa Tribune - Roger Mooney
